Job Description

The UK Education Counsellor will be responsible for providing professional guidance and support to students seeking educational opportunities in the United Kingdom. The role involves understanding each student’s academic goals, assisting with university selection, application processes, visa documentation, and maintaining up-to-date knowledge about UK institutions, courses, and immigration policies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Counsel students regarding study options in the UK, including courses, universities, and admission requirements.
  • Assist students throughout the application and visa process.
  • Maintain strong communication with UK institutions and relevant partners.
  • Conduct information sessions, follow-ups, and regular meetings with prospective students.
  • Ensure timely updates and accurate records of student files and progress.
  • Provide pre-departure guidance and support.
  • Meet individual and team targets as set by management.
Job Specification
  • Bachelor’s Degree in any discipline (preferably Management, Education, or related field).
  • Minimum 1 year of experience as an education counselor (UK counseling experience preferred).
  • In-depth knowledge of UK education systems, institutions, and visa procedures.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ong command of English (spoken and written).
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Pleasant personality with a professional attitude.
